GetParameters


class description - source file - inheritance tree

class GetParameters : public TObject


    public:
GetParameters GetParameters(FILE* parFile) GetParameters GetParameters(GetParameters&) void ~GetParameters() TClass* Class() TString* getBarrelTableFile() TString* getDetectorName() Float_t getEMcosThetaSeg() Float_t getEMEnergyScale() Float_t getEMphiSeg() TString* getEndcapTableFile() Float_t getHADcosThetaSeg() Float_t getHADEnergyScale() Float_t getHADphiSeg() Float_t getLUMcosThetaSeg() Float_t getLUMEnergyScale() Float_t getLUMphiSeg() Int_t getMinHit() Float_t getMUcosThetaSeg() Float_t getMUEnergyScale() Float_t getMUphiSeg() Float_t getPolarInner() Float_t getPolarOuter() Float_t getPTMin() virtual TClass* IsA() virtual void ShowMembers(TMemberInspector& insp, char* parent) virtual void Streamer(TBuffer& b)

Data Members

private:
Int_t m_minHit min hit for track acceptance Float_t m_PtMin min momentum for track acceptance Float_t m_PolarInner polar angle acceptance for tracking barrel Float_t m_PolarOuter polar angle acceptance for tracking ec Float_t m_EMEnergyScale EM emergy scale for sampling Float_t m_HADEnergyScale HAD emergy scale for sampling Float_t m_MUEnergyScale MU emergy scale for sampling Float_t m_LUMEnergyScale LUM emergy scale for sampling Float_t m_EMcosThetaSeg EM cos(Theta) segmentation Float_t m_HADcosThetaSeg HAD cos(Theta) segmentation Float_t m_MUcosThetaSeg MU cos(Theta) segmentation Float_t m_LUMcosThetaSeg ELU cos(Theta) segmentation Float_t m_EMphiSeg EM phi segmentation Float_t m_HADphiSeg HAD phi segmentation Float_t m_MUphiSeg MU phi segmentation Float_t m_LUMphiSeg LUM phi segmentation TString m_BarrelTableFile to find barrel-specific tracking parameters TString m_EndcapTableFile to find endcap-specific tracking parameters TString m_DetectorName nickname for detector geometry

Class Description

 GetParameters

 This class is a temporary expedient (until a more flexible method
 is available) for getting parameters to a reconstruction program,
 such as Fast MC or FullRecon.

GetParameters(FILE* parFile)
 Constructor.  Read and digest parameter file and progeny.



Inline Functions


                Int_t getMinHit()
              Float_t getPTMin()
              Float_t getPolarInner()
              Float_t getPolarOuter()
              Float_t getEMEnergyScale()
              Float_t getHADEnergyScale()
              Float_t getMUEnergyScale()
              Float_t getLUMEnergyScale()
              Float_t getEMcosThetaSeg()
              Float_t getHADcosThetaSeg()
              Float_t getMUcosThetaSeg()
              Float_t getLUMcosThetaSeg()
              Float_t getEMphiSeg()
              Float_t getHADphiSeg()
              Float_t getMUphiSeg()
              Float_t getLUMphiSeg()
             TString* getBarrelTableFile()
             TString* getEndcapTableFile()
             TString* getDetectorName()
              TClass* Class()
              TClass* IsA()
                 void ShowMembers(TMemberInspector& insp, char* parent)
                 void Streamer(TBuffer& b)
        GetParameters GetParameters(GetParameters&)
                 void ~GetParameters()


ROOT page - Class index - Top of the page

This page has been automatically generated. If you have any comments or suggestions about the page layout send a mail to ROOT support, or contact the developers with any questions or problems regarding ROOT.